Panabit Support Board!

 找回密碼
 注冊

QQ登錄

只需一步,快速開始

  Wave2 千兆AP首發,在70周年國慶之際向祖國母親問好 !了解詳情請點擊這里
搜索
熱搜: 活動 交友 discuz
查看: 2968|回復: 1
打印 上一主題 下一主題

Panabit終極修復大法(FreeBSD版適用,Linux版未測試)

[復制鏈接]
跳轉到指定樓層
1#
發表于 2020-8-20 09:43:31 | 只看該作者 回帖獎勵 |倒序瀏覽 |閱讀模式
本帖最后由 rockrock99 于 2020-8-21 02:22 編輯

準備工作:
把當前版本對應的升級包,通過各種方式(scp/wget/fetch/...)傳到/log下,然后執行以下代碼。

神秘代碼如下:
/bin/sh
. /etc/PG.conf
file=`ls *.tar.gz | awk -F'.' '{print $1}'`
tar xf ${file}.tar.gz
rm -rf ${file}.tar.gz
cd ${file}
rm admin/.htpasswd
tar zcf tmp.tar.gz *
#永久替換版本,應急使用(重啟后恢復當前版本),請勿執行紅字部分
tar xf tmp.tar.gz -C ${PGPATH}

tar xf tmp.tar.gz -C /usr/ramdisk
cd ..
rm -rf ${file}
/bin/csh

執行完以上代碼,系統就修復好了。剩下就是按需重啟服務。

例如:

重啟httpd服務:
killall ipe_httpd
/usr/ramdisk/bin/ipectrl start httpd

備注:
以上方法僅供有一定基礎的網友在無法訪問web界面狀態下修復系統,小白請不要輕易嘗試,不當操作會引起系統崩潰。切記!切記!
2#
 樓主| 發表于 2020-8-21 01:00:58 | 只看該作者
本帖最后由 rockrock99 于 2020-8-21 02:17 編輯

更新日志:
2020-08-21
1.提前清理升級包,節約臨時空間。
2.重新整理代碼,增加永久替換部分。
您需要登錄后才可以回帖 登錄 | 注冊

本版積分規則

QQ|小黑屋|手機版|Archiver|北京派網軟件有限公司 ( )

GMT+8, 2020-9-24 22:21 , Processed in 0.063759 second(s), 14 queries .

Powered by X3.4

万人德扑Copyright © 2001-2020, Tencent Cloud.

快速回復 返回頂部 返回列表